Find the value of 935493 - 54.

STEP 1

Assumptions
1. We are performing a subtraction operation.
2. The numbers involved in the operation are 93 and 54.

STEP 2

To subtract two numbers, we write them one under the other, aligning the digits according to their place value.
\begin{array}{c@{}c} & 9\phantom{0}3 \\ - & 5\phantom{0}4 \\ \end{array}

STEP 3

Subtract the digits in the ones place. Subtract the bottom digit from the top digit in the ones column.
343 - 4
Since 3 is less than 4, we cannot subtract 4 from 3 without going into negative numbers. Therefore, we need to borrow from the tens place.

STEP 4

Borrow 1 from the tens place of the top number (9 becomes 8, and the 3 becomes 13).
\begin{array}{c@{}c} & 8\phantom{0}(13) \\ - & 5\phantom{0}4 \\ \end{array}

STEP 5

Now subtract the ones place digits.
134=913 - 4 = 9

STEP 6

Write the result of the ones place subtraction below the line.
\begin{array}{c@{}c} & 8\phantom{0}(13) \\ - & 5\phantom{0}4 \\ \cline{1-2} & \phantom{0}9 \\ \end{array}

STEP 7

Subtract the digits in the tens place. Subtract the bottom digit from the top digit in the tens column.
85=38 - 5 = 3

STEP 8

Write the result of the tens place subtraction below the line.
\begin{array}{c@{}c} & 8\phantom{0}(13) \\ - & 5\phantom{0}4 \\ \cline{1-2} & 39 \\ \end{array}

STEP 9

Combine the results to get the final answer.
9354=3993 - 54 = 39
The solution to the subtraction problem is 39.
